  Complete List of Infinity Key Combinations
Posted by: denishessberger - 19-02-2021, 02:14 PM - Forum: Chimp Tips and Tricks - No Replies

Infinity Key Funktionen:

Infinity + Temp = Opens Page Directory

Infinity + Open + S1 = Calibrate Internal Screen
Infinity + Open + S2 = Calibrate Secondary Screen
Infinity + Open + S4 = Restart User Interface

Infinity + Skip = Skip Backwards (In Selected Cuelist)
Infinity + Open = Closes all Dialog Windows
Infinity + Select = Clears current Selection
Infinity + Off = Releases all Cuelists
Infinity + Fpg+ = Sets Fader Page to 1
Infinity + EPg+ = Sets Executor Page to 1

Infinity + Highlight = Toggles Solo
Infinity + Clear = Brings back the last programmer content from before clearing
Infinity + Load = Loads all Output for currently selected fixtures
Infinity + Prev = Selects all fixtures with values in programmer
Infinity + Next = Selects all fixtures from original selection set
Infinity + Encoder Turn = Sets Fine Values for this Attribute

Infinity + Edit + Fader Go / Pause Button = Opens the Settings Tab for the Cuelist on the Playback Page 
Infinity + Edit + Executor Button = Opens the Settings Tab for the Cuelist on the Playback Page 

Infinity + Cuelist Item in Cuelist Pool: Deselects the Cuelist
Infinity + Preset Item in Preset Pool: Loads the Presets Values for selected fixtures instead of a reference to the preset.

If Scroll is shown for an encoder:
Infinity + Encoder Button will scroll to bottom
Encoder Button only will scroll to top

Tables:
Infinity (Or Shift on Keyboard) + Clicking in a Multiselect Table will select multiple Cells
Infinity (Or Shift on Keyboard + Arrow Keys on Keyboard will allow to make a multi selection

Toolbars:

Selection Toolbar:
Infinity + All = Selects all fixtures with values in programmer

Off Toolbar:
Infinity + Reset Group Master Button = Resets all Groupmasters to 100% without asking for confirmation
Infinity + Reset Cuelist Fader Button = Resets all Groupmasters to 100% without asking for confirmation
Infinity + Off All Playbacks Button =  Offs all Cuelists without asking for confirmation
Infinity + Release Everything = Resets / Offs EVERYTHING without asking for confirmation

Dialogs:

Shutdown / Reboot Dialog:
Infinity + Reboot Button in Dialog = Quit / Restart Application Only
Infinity + Shutdown Button in Dialog = Quit / Restart Application Only

Fixture Library Editors:

Add Multiple Ranges Dialog:
Infinity will show all values in 16bit

Add or Edit Ranges Dialog:
Infinity will show all values in 16bit

Module Channel Editor:
Infinity will show all values in 16bit

Output View:
Infinity will show all values in 16bit

MagicSheets:
Infinity during Rectangle Selection: Selection will be inverted

  [Fixed in 1.02] All, v1.01 - Library / Show Import may fail
Posted by: denishessberger - 11-02-2021, 06:10 PM - Forum: LAMPY Bug Reports - No Replies

We have identified an issue in the software where files can not be imported again if they have been renamed after export.

As a workaround either set the name directly in the software prior to exporting, or if you have a file that was exported earlier where import fails:

Copy the file to another folder on the computer.
Rename the copy's file ending to .tgz
Unpack the .tgz using a Compression Utility such as archiver in MacOS or WinRar in Windows.
This will create a new folder named after the file. Open this folder. In the folder you'll find a .lib or .show file, copy and paste the name before the .lib or .show file ending.
Rename the file on the stick to this name.
Import again.

We have entered the issue into our issue tracking system, but no ETA on when this will be fixed yet.

  [Fixed in 1.02] Lampy 20, version 1.01, Cannot set pan fan from position preset
Posted by: jjlinnemann - 14-01-2021, 10:17 AM - Forum: LAMPY Bug Reports - Replies (1)

Type of the Desk: Lampy 20 with dongle

Software Version: 1.01

External Display Connected, is a touchscreen?: Yes, Dell P2418HT touchscreen

Connected USB Devices: keyboard and mouse

Networked Devices: connected to LAN, DHCP

Description:
You cannot set fan for pan or tilt if you start from a position preset

Steps to reproduce:
- Select a few moving heads
- Select a position preset that includes pan and tilt values
- Press the fan button
- Select the Values home screen
- Now turn the Pan Fan encoder to fan the pan

Expected Behavior:
I would expect the pan to fan

Observed Behavior:
The pan does not fan initially. However, in the values screen, the tilt value changes from the preset to the raw value. If I then turn the Pan Fan encoder, the pan does fan. This bug only applies to the Pan Fan. If I change the Tilt Fan, it does work immediately.
